Transaction 02ab4e9458875885a1c523c7116255def1863b9440e011bf3722a87920420561
2 Input
2 Outputs
- 02ab4e9458875885a1c523c7116255def1863b9440e011bf3722a87920420561:0
- 02ab4e9458875885a1c523c7116255def1863b9440e011bf3722a87920420561:1
value 120000000
address 18fbVfNM5N1V4iDBR8bVcXzLZkWuJbxqkb
value 25590000
address 1CKZ6cYp3RtBkxs7JZ1bqtEgizPtcKRWAS